Wojciech Wiliński has died. Star of ‘Misio’, ‘Czterdziestolatka’ and ‘Klan’ was 86 years old

Polish culture has lost another legend. Wojciech Wiliński, star of 'Misia', 'Czterdziestolatka' and 'Klan', has died. The actor was 86 years old and for more than half a century appeared on stage and screen, winning the hearts of audiences.

Who was Wojciech Wiliński? Esteemed film and theatre actor dead

Wojciech Wiliński is dead – the sad news has circulated the media and moved the artistic community. For years the actor was one of the recognisable faces of Polish cinema, theatre and television. Audiences remembered him for his roles in cult productions such as ‘Miś’, ‘Czterdziestolatek’ or the series ‘Klan’.

Although he often appeared in supporting roles, he was able to give his characters character and authenticity. Thanks to this, he went down in the audience’s memory as an actor of extraordinary stage charisma.

Wojciech Wiliński – acting career and most important roles

Wojciech Wiliński was born on 1 February 1940 in Warsaw. He came from a family with acting traditions – his parents were stage artists, which brought him into contact with the theatre from an early age.

He began his career at the end of the 1950s and performed in, among others, the Musical Theatre in Gdynia, and later he was also associated with Warsaw theatres, including the Syrena Theatre and the Jewish Theatre. It was with the latter theatre that he was associated for many years of his career.

The theatre was extremely important to him – it was there that he created many memorable stage creations and won the recognition of the audience.

Cult productions featuring Wojciech Wiliński

Although he spent most of his career on the theatre stage, a wide audience knew him from films and TV series. The best-known productions with the actor’s participation are: “Miś””Czterdziestolatek”, “Czterdziestolatek. 20 lat później’, ‘Klan’ and ‘Pitbull’. It is thanks to these productions that Wojciech Wiliński’s name has become recognisable among many generations of viewers.
